Gabriel C, who is known in Belgium as Lange Vingers (Long fingers) fakes his death during a desperate attempt to avoid going to jail.

This drug dealer staged photographs of himself being ‘Tortured’ to death, with the word “Thief” being carved in his chest.

Afterwards, he release the images of himself seemingly in a chair with his hands bound and fake injuries across his body.

This image were presented as proof he had been tortured to death by a rival drug gang after he had been busted for stealing cocaine that he had been tasked with ensuring made passage to a port in Antwerp.

Despite all, the authorities have failed yo fall for the “torture to death” ploy and he has since been arrested and charged.

The criminal had attempted to sell the drugs he siphoned off from the shipment he was supposed to supervise.

Earlier last year, he went into hiding after the Albanian drugs gang he stole from made him a marked man.

In 2015, he committed strings of offenses and was seriously wanted.

These fake images first surfaced last year but experts last December ruled the images fraudulent

Brussels Times reported at the time: “The visible wounds are most likely the work of professional make-up artists, probably someone working in the film world.”

Here is what it stated: “The wounds on his body, apparently fatal, are fake, according to four doctors who studied the images, including one forensic pathologist.”

Luckily enough, Belgian authorities reduced his sentence from five years to four years ever following the fails attempts to convince police he was dead.

In a court session, his lawyer argued that he was sorry for his past crimes and claimed his wife and three-year-old son have taught him what taking responsibility meant.
